ok I was short on cash for a new fuel pump.so i took the tank from my 89 that i'm parting out to put in my 90,well the tanks in and the car is running but now my fuel gauge is dead.the 89's gauge worked perfectly and the 90's gauge worked before the tank swap.evrytime i fix something on my car something else breaks,i think it likes the attention.any ideas on how to fix the dead gauge?

i would pull the tank back down and see if the float is stuck and check the plug on top of the sending unit
 
When you lowered it the first time did it put any tension on the wires/connector? While it is down and out(so to speak) Check the connector for terminals that may have been pulled back or wire breaks between there and the first support point for that loom.
